Taylor Swift played her first of seven planned concerts in Germany on Wednesday evening. However, an incident occurred beforehand.

The city of Gelsenkirchen prepared meticulously for Taylor Swift’s performance on the evening of July 17th. It was her first of seven concerts in Germany as part of “The Eras Tour”.

Before the singer’s performance, however, the police had to arrive and take a stalker into custody. The man had previously made threats against the singer, said a police spokeswoman. She did not initially provide any further details about the person or the background.

Shortly before 8 p.m. on Wednesday evening, the singer was able to get going after the incident: After the opening act Paramore had played, the pop superstar entered the stage of the Veltins Arena in Gelsenkirchen. Swift greeted her numerous fans in German with the words: “Welcome to the Eras Tour. Good evening.”

Overall, the concert was a peaceful event with around 60,000 visitors. However, the fans’ departure was delayed due to another police operation in nearby Erle. A 70-year-old man had called the police for help, the spokeswoman said. According to the report, when the officers arrived they heard loud bangs, whereupon they cordoned off the scene and part of the road to the adjacent arena. The man was in a state of psychological distress, was overpowered and taken to hospital. It was initially unclear what caused the loud bangs.

After yesterday’s show, Swift will play two more concerts at the Schalke Arena – on Thursday and Friday. After that, she will head to Hamburg for performances on July 23 and 24 and after München for shows on July 27 and 28.
